Shelf fillers stock shelves and display areas and keep stock clean and in order in supermarkets and other retail and wholesale shops.

Check your pay
- The majority of Shelf fillers earn a salary between R4 356 and R14 232 per month in 2024.
- A monthly wage for entry-level Shelf fillers ranges from R4 356 to R7 654.
- After gaining 5 years of work experience, their income will be between R5 547 and R10 315 per month.

Duties and tasks
- Placing goods neatly in bins and on racks, and stacking bulky goods on floors
- Filling shelves with goods and ensuring that goods with the earliest use-by dates are at the front of shelves
- Removing goods with past due use-by dates
- Maintaining shelf order by removing stock belonging in a different location
- Noting what has been sold and collecting goods needed from the stockroom
- Obtaining articles for customers from shelf or stockroom
- Directing customers to location of articles sought
- Receiving, opening, unpacking and inspecting for damage merchandise from manufacturer or distributor
